Specification Compliance

Header Structure Compliance

Header Size: Exactly 348 bytes as required
Magic Numbers: Proper validation of "ni1\0" and "n+1\0"
Field Layout: All fields positioned according to specification
Endianness Detection: Automatic detection via sizeof_hdr field

Data Type Compliance

All Standard Types: Support for all NIfTI-1 data types (DT_UINT8 through DT_RGBA32)
Bitpix Validation: Correct bits-per-pixel for each data type
Type Consistency: Validation that datatype and bitpix fields match
Byte Order: Proper handling of big-endian and little-endian data

Dimension Compliance

Dimension Limits: 1-7 dimensions as specified
Spatial Dimensions: X, Y, Z must be positive integers
Temporal Dimension: Fourth dimension for time series
Vector Dimensions: Fifth+ dimensions for multi-component data

Coordinate System Compliance

Transform Codes: All NIFTI_XFORM_* constants match specification
Quaternions: Unit quaternion validation (b²+c²+d² ≤ 1)
Affine Transforms: Support for srow_x/y/z matrices
Pixel Dimensions: Proper handling of pixdim array

File Format Compliance

Single File (.nii): vox_offset ≥ 352, preferably multiple of 16
Dual File (.hdr/.img): vox_offset = 0 for header files
Compression: Proper gzip handling for .gz files
Extensions: Support for header extensions when present

Units and Scaling Compliance

Spatial Units: NIFTI_UNITS_METER, NIFTI_UNITS_MM, NIFTI_UNITS_MICRON
Temporal Units: NIFTI_UNITS_SEC, NIFTI_UNITS_MSEC, etc.
Unit Encoding: Proper bit-field encoding in xyzt_units
Data Scaling: scl_slope and scl_inter handling

Intent Code Compliance

Statistical Codes: All statistical intent codes (NIFTI_FIRST_STATCODE to NIFTI_LAST_STATCODE)
Non-Statistical Codes: ESTIMATE, LABEL, VECTOR, etc.
Parameter Validation: Appropriate parameter counts for statistical tests

Validation Tools

NiftiValidator Class

Programmatic validation with detailed reporting:

var result = NiftiValidator.ValidateFile("brain.nii");
if (result.IsValid)
{
    Console.WriteLine("File is NIfTI-1 compliant");
}
else
{
    Console.WriteLine($"Validation failed: {result.Errors.Count} errors");
    foreach (var error in result.Errors)
    {
        Console.WriteLine($"  - {error}");
    }
}

Command-Line Tool

Batch validation with comprehensive reporting:

# Validate single file
NiftiConformanceChecker brain.nii

# Validate multiple files with verbose output
NiftiConformanceChecker -v --info *.nii

# Recursive directory validation
NiftiConformanceChecker -r /data/nifti/

Usage Examples

Basic Validation

// Validate header programmatically
var header = NiftiFile.ReadHeader("scan.nii");
if (header.IsValid())
{
    Console.WriteLine("Header is valid");
}

// Comprehensive validation
var result = NiftiValidator.ValidateFile("scan.nii");
Console.WriteLine(result.ToString());

Creating Compliant Files

// Library automatically creates compliant headers
var data = new float[64 * 64 * 32];
var nifti = Nifti.CreateFromData(data, new int[] { 64, 64, 32 });

// Validation passes automatically
Debug.Assert(nifti.Header.IsValid());
Debug.Assert(NiftiValidator.ValidateDataConsistency(nifti).IsValid);

Custom Validation

// Check specific requirements
var header = new NiftiHeader();
// ... set fields ...

try
{
    header.ValidateHeader();
    Console.WriteLine("Header passes all validation checks");
}
catch (InvalidDataException ex)
{
    Console.WriteLine($"Validation failed: {ex.Message}");
}
